Nordicon system
Nordicon system offers the possibility to combine different materials in the same facade: steel, wood, glass, stone, tile, render and ceramic tile. Nordicon, which is based on lightweight technique, does not put restrictions on choosing the frame of the building. Nordicon is suitable for residential, commercial and office constructions. It can also be applied to the repair of old facades as well as additional storey building.
Nordicon is a new generation facade system with several advantages. The facade structure is ventilating and it does not form heat bridges. The structure is dry from the beginning. Wider variations of openings of exterior and interior walls offer plenty of new possibilities for flexible layout utilization. Basic structural frame for Nordicon element is created from Thermo Purlins. Its web perforation reduces considerably the heat flow going through the thermo purlin. Research and experience from use have proved the excellent function of Termo Purlin and its moisture and acoustic techniques. As it is based on steel, it is non-combustible, stable and precise in measures. Termo Purlin is a result of a long-term development of Rautaruukki, Rannila and the VTT Technical Research Centre of Finland. Pre-fabricated Wall Elements:
The most common method is to pre-fabricate wall elements from the profiles at the factory in order to shorten the time needed for construction work on the building site. Elements can be delivered object-made with thermal insulation and wall plates, or as completely ready elements with windows and doors installed.

When constructing a house from thermopanels at the building site only a light lift is needed and a brigade of a few men. Wall construction will go fast as most work operations have already been made at the factory. Panels with specific measurements are set in place, attached to the foundation and/ or partition ceilings, and connection joints will be made dense. All materials used for exterior padding are suitable for façade materials. For roof carriers, in general, are thorn plate-wooden frames, foundations are built following the common project rules of thumb. Panel interior walls may be covered with materials suitable for purposes of rooms.
Thermopanels
Thermopanel walls are exterior walls, which standing structure is made of thermobatten. In case of thermopanel system the entire building will be mounted from large elements manufactured at a factory. Stiffness of thermopanel system is guaranteed by construction plates covering the structure from both sides, in case of need also by additional support structures placed underneath plates. The frames are entirely filled with mineral or rock wool filling and a vapour barrier is installed in the inner surface of the walls.

Thermopanel is comprised of:
1. Enforced plaster plate 13 mm 2. Vapour barrier plastic 0,2 mm 3. Mineral filling 200 mm 4. Thermoprofile structure/ frame 200 mm 5. Wind barrier plaster plate 9 mm
Thermoprofiles
Thermoprofile or thermobatten is a thin-walled bent profile made of galvanized steel sheet, which is meant for construction of exterior wall structures and facades. The strength of steel and good workability allows making light, thin but at the same time strong constructions. The perforation in the center part of thermoprofile cross-section cuts through the cold bridge, reducing substantially steel sheet’s thermoconductivity. Thermoprofile and for the same cross-section wooden beam thermal technical showings are in the same class. Also thermo- profile walls sound isolation features are on a good level. For example, the measured attenuation of traffic noise of a panel of 175-mm profile is 43 dB and the attenuation of other outer noise is 51 dB.

Pre-Cut System: The pre-cut Thermo Profiles are installed to act as a frame at the building site. After that, walls are thermal insulated with mineral wool, wall plates as well as windows are installed, and the facade cladding is put in place.
Applications:
In the exterior walls of detached family and terraced houses, the Termo Profiles are mostly used as the load-bearing structure. In residential multi-storey buildings, the Termo Profiles are mostly used as the load-bearing part of the facade, but they don’t bear floors or the roof, i.e., the Termo Profile walls are used as non-load bearing exterior walls. It is recommended to use square-like or band-like elements for commercial and office buildings. The Termo Profiles are also suitable for renovation. When building additional storeys and spaces, the Thermo Profiles are used in the same way as in new buildings. Where old facades are repaired, the Termo Profiles can be used as a frame structure for a new cladding which substitutes the demolished cladding or the exterior surface.
